lipopolysaccharide
Pronunciation: lip′ō-pol′ē-sak′ă-rīd
Definition:
- A compound or complex of lipid and carbohydrate.
- The lipopolysaccharide (endotoxin) released from the cell walls of gram-negative organisms that produces septic shock.
